ALS CANADA
SENIOR MANAGER, LEADERSHIP GIFTS
Position Overview
Organization: ALS Canada
Title: Senior Manager, Leadership Gifts
Reports to: Vice President, Fund Development
Team: One direct report: Specialist, Fund Development
Location: Hybrid work model, minimum two days a week in office (180 Bloor Street West, Toronto)
Compensation: $95,000 to $110,000, plus a comprehensive benefits and vacation package. Compensation will be determined commensurate with experience.
Use of AI: Artificial intelligence is not currently used to screen, assess, or select applicants at any stage of the hiring process.
